Norfolk, VA – Injuries Reported in Crash Near E Little Creek Rd; Police Report Requested

September 5, 2025

Norfolk, VA (September 5, 2025) – A motor vehicle accident with injuries occurred Thursday afternoon near East Little Creek Road in Norfolk, prompting medical attention and a formal police report request by an injured individual involved in the incident.

According to dispatch communications from Norfolk Police’s 2nd Precinct, the crash took place at approximately 3:50 p.m. and involved at least one individual who reported back and neck injuries. The injured party was reportedly a rideshare passenger and remained at the scene, requesting documentation due to the sustained injuries.

The drivers involved—operating a black Ford Fusion and another vehicle described as a “Blue Monster 6″—exchanged information before authorities arrived. A school bus was also briefly mentioned in the dispatch, though it’s unclear whether it was directly involved in the crash. Children were reported to be transferred from one bus to another as a precautionary measure.

Emergency crews responded quickly, and Norfolk Police officers began the process of compiling a formal accident report to assist the injured party with potential insurance or legal claims.

At this time, no further injuries have been reported, and the full extent of the victim’s condition remains unknown.
